Overview
Enlist as a soldier into the United States Army and become a Bridge Crew member. They provide conventional and powered bridge and rafting support for wet and dry gap crossing operations. This is not a civilian contractor position.
No experience necessary. Position is entry level.
- Construct bridges and rafts to help Soldiers cross rough terrain, bodies of water, and barriers they might encounter in the field.
- You will help create floating bridges and rafts from a boat as well as help combat engineers create safe crossings on land by building structures or demolishing obstacles.
- 10 weeks of Basic Training
- 4 weeks of Technical School with on-the-job instructions.
- 30 days paid vacation annually.
- Full Healthcare coverage for you and your Family.
- Educational benefits worth over $72,000.
- Obtain Industry standard recognized certifications.
- Between 17-34 years old.
- No felonies. (Defer Adjudication included).
- Current High School Senior, High school graduate or GED equivalent.
- Permanent resident or US citizen.
- Meet physical standards based on gender and age.
- Pass the Armed Services Vocational Aptitude Battery (ASVAB) test
